Output 7d79f3fab708cc02ed6a9e2685480f3256edbf37eb0cc8aec26527ede4d4cf65:4

value
76558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b2303abedc254c23fcff667889b75d8b9b0aed OP_EQUAL
address
3HAHai8SV344Axhjv8uB6aMdDpg5AHTu5u
transaction
7d79f3fab708cc02ed6a9e2685480f3256edbf37eb0cc8aec26527ede4d4cf65
confirmations
169844
spent
true